Resetting the Handset Without the Base

If your original base is not available for some reason (for example, it is lost or somehow incapacitated), you can still reset the handset and use it with another base.

.Press and hold [ ] and [#/>] for at least 5 seconds.

2.Move the cursor to select REPLACING BASE and then press [select/]. REPLACE BASE appears.

3.Move the cursor to select YES, and then press [select/]. You hear a confirmation tone, and the handset deletes its own base information without contacting the base. The handset displays MODELS VARY!

CHARGE HANDSET ON THE BASE FOR REGISTRATION OR REFER TO OWNER’S MANUAL.

4.Register the handset to the new base (see Registering Accessory Handsets on page 20).

Changing the Digital Security Code

The digital security code is an identification code used to connect the handset and the base. Your unit ships from the manufacturer with a preset security code. Resetting this code is not normally necessary. In the rare situation that you suspect another cordless telephone is using the same security code or if you are instructed to change this code by a manufacturer’s Call Center Representative, you can change the code. To change the digital security code:

.Reset the handset (see Resetting the Handset on page 59).

2.Re-register each handset (see Registering Accessory Handsets on page 20).
